Former Gov. Jeb Bush joins 'Don't Let Florida Go to Pot Coalition'
South Florida Caribbean News
"Florida leaders and citizens have worked for years to make the Sunshine State a world-class location to start or run a business, a family-friendly destination for tourism and a desirable place to raise a family or retire," said Gov. Jeb Bush. "Allowing large-scale, marijuana operations to take root across Florida, under the guise of using it for medicinal purposes, runs counter to all of these efforts. I believe it is the right of states to decide this issue, and I strongly urge Floridians to vote against Amendment 2 this November."

Gov. Scott honors two with the Medal of Heroism
Capital Soup
Governor Rick Scott said, "I am honored to present Detective Robert Smith and Trooper Marcos Diaz with the Medal of Heroism. Both Detective Robert Smith and Trooper Diaz did not think twice about placing their own lives in danger during the line-of-duty in order to protect their fellow Floridians and fellow law enforcement officers. Thanks to the quick response and heroic actions of these two heroes, lives were saved and Floridians were kept safe."

Sheriffs present Legislative Champion Award to Sen. Simmons
Florida Sheriffs Association
Each year, the Florida Sheriffs Association recognizes state legislators who have made significant contributions to criminal justice and public safety through their leadership. "Senator (David) Simmons has always opened his door to Florida sheriffs and he is a strong advocate for public safety," said Sheriff Don Eslinger. "He delves into complex issues and takes a methodical and analytical approach. He is truly an asset to the Senate, to law enforcement, and to the communities we collectively serve."
Florida sheriff's department shares touching letter from former homeless man thanking deputy for turning his life around
New York Daily News
The heartwarming letter addressed to the Palm Beach County Sheriff's Department recognizes one of their deputies, Alex Alphonso, for helping him — and his four-legged "best friend" — get back on his feet again after losing his job and home on the same day.
